Pork, fresh, loin, center loin (chops), boneless, separable lean and fat, cooked, pan-broiled contains 229 calories per 100g, according to the USDA FoodData Central database. How many calories are in Pork, fresh, loin, center loin (chops), boneless, separable lean and fat, cooked, pan-broiled?
Pork, fresh, loin, center loin (chops), boneless, separable lean and fat, cooked, pan-broiled contains 229 calories per 100g. It has 26.7g of protein, 13.6g of fat, and 0g of carbohydrates.
How much sodium is in Pork, fresh, loin, center loin (chops), boneless, separable lean and fat, cooked, pan-broiled?
Pork, fresh, loin, center loin (chops), boneless, separable lean and fat, cooked, pan-broiled contains 86mg of sodium per 100g, which is 4% of the recommended daily limit (2,300mg).
